Make a positive difference in students’ lives by delivering individualized instruction as a Special Education Teacher. This contract opportunity is located near Staten Island, NY, and is ideal for dedicated educators passionate about creating an inclusive learning environment where every child’s abilities are recognized and supported.
Qualifications:
- Valid Special Education Teacher certification (state-specific, or ability to obtain)
- Bachelor’s degree (Master’s preferred) in Special Education or related field
- Previous experience working with K-12 students in a special education setting
- Solid knowledge of IEP processes and development of student-centered goals
- Ability to adapt instructional materials and methods for students with various learning differences
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ills to effectively partner with families, staff, and administration
- Excellent classroom management and organizational abilities
What You’ll Do:
- Develop, implement, and review Individualized Education Programs (IEPs)
- Provide direct instruction and support to students in a resource room or inclusive classroom setting
- Collaborate closely with general education teachers, therapists, and support staff to promote student success
- Track and report student progress, modifying approaches as needed
- Participate in IEP meetings, parent conferences, and multidisciplinary team discussions
- Foster a positive, supportive classroom where students feel empowered and valued
- Use data-driven strategies and evidence-based interventions to support learning growth
